5 of My Favorite Neutral Eyeshadow Palettes

With so many neutral palettes available these days, it can be hard to keep them all straight! These are my current favorites that are permanent…

  1. Urban Decay Naked — the original is still a go-to for travel for me, though I love Naked2 and Naked3 as well
  2. LORAC Pro Palette — 16 shades of neutrals from matte to shimmer
  3. Chanel Raffinement — smokier, cooler neutrals
  4. bareMinerals The Truth — cooler-toned, darker neutrals
  5. LORAC Unzipped — warm, shimmery pinks, browns, and bronzes

The UD palettes are fantastic quality, though not what I’d recommend for the truly cool-toned. Neutral and warmer toned women will get great use out of them, though. The Lorac palettes are a little more friendly but still lean warm.

Too Faced Naked Eye and NYX Butt Naked are fairly good neutral palettes for us cool-toned ladies, though the face products in the latter run warm (and I think it was LE?). I’ve also been eyeing Chanel’s Prelude palette as a big splurge. Who can’t use more taupe in their life? 🙂
